Our "New" Building

What was once an ugly cinder block box has been transformed. With the help of Dwight McNeill, Jolly Construction, Cathay and Company Stucco and friends and family, our place has turned into this beautiful, bright gem of a building. We still have lots to do before opening night, but the exterior of Three Blacksmiths now has its proper evening attire on and will soon be free of scaffolding, ladders and drop cloths altogether. And while the exterior work has been going on, the interior has been getting the once over as well. The finishing touches are being applied to the paint and trim and the tile work is just about complete. The kitchen equipment is in place and the centerpiece of the restaurant, an Isokern open hearth fireplace, will be installed this weekend. The light at the end of the tunnel is most definitely getting brighter!
